Folder Marker context menu gone!

Does anyone has experience with Folder Marker? It allows you to give a different color to your folders for easy organization. Now, I used to have a shortcut in the context menu. Suddenly, I don't see it anymore.

Any ideas on how to bring it back to the context menu?

Thanks!

Go to Start/Run and type in:

regsvr32 /i shell32

Click OK.

Restart your computer.
